Man accused of shooting at Circus Circus security officers arrested

Updated Thursday, Dec. 6, 2012 | 3:25 p.m.

A man accused of shooting at Circus Circus security officers after he was caught breaking into a car in the parking garage was arrested Thursday, Metro Police said.

Joshua Olvera, 22, of Las Vegas was booked into the Clark County Detention Center on three counts of attempted murder with a weapon and one count of burglary with a weapon, officials said.

Police received reports about 3 a.m. of a shooting in the area of the 3000 block of South Industrial Road.

Police said three security officers had interrupted an auto burglary while on patrol inside the casino parking garage. A man ran away and fired several shots from a handgun at the officers, but no one was hit, police said.

The officers were armed, but they did not return fire. They helped police locate and identify the suspect, authorities said.
